Protocol Education Ltd in Leeds is seeking a dedicated BSL Teaching Assistant to support pupils with hearing impairments. This full-time position offers a competitive pay rate between Β£100 and Β£115 per day.

The ideal candidate will have BSL Level 3 or higher and experience working with children. You will provide personalized support, promote social development, and help create an inclusive classroom.

Flexible long-term opportunities across Leeds are available, enhancing professional development and direct consultant support.
